摘要
This paper is focused on the study of charged wormholes which are combinations of Morris-Thorne wormhole and Reissner-Nordstrom spacetime. Gravitational lensing is an important tool which has been adopted to detect various objects like wormholes using the notion of deflection angle. In this work, we have evaluated deflection angle with and without using the strong field limit coefficients and compared the results. Further, exact charged wormhole solutions are obtained in f(R, T) gravity and the nature of the energy conditions is examined.
